Transaction 8b8b32bd9dddde6eebc6ad09f59fc98f18eb51c246105099a81b05b3d94c1908
3 Input
1 Outputs
- 8b8b32bd9dddde6eebc6ad09f59fc98f18eb51c246105099a81b05b3d94c1908:0
value 83881981
address 147EAKZ1Xndz2UQ29SbaWiWaJPMsm98q7x